JPPF’s concern over sale of forms on exorbitant rates

Excelsior Correspondent
JAMMU, Sept 30: Jammu Province People Forum (JPPF) has flayed the coalition Government for selling forms among the youth on exorbitant rate of Rs 300 and Rs 400 per form.
Addressing a meeting, the President of the Forum, Pavittar Singh Bhardwaj said that the selling of the form on such a high rate is really cause of concern not only for the unemployed youth but indirectly to their parents, who have provided education to their wards at the cost of their livelihood.
Bhardwaj appealed to the Chief Minister to consider the plight of the unemployed youth, who fill forms various times involving thousands of rupees to get selected for the job on the bleak chance of selection.
He expressed his dismay over the way the Government is tackling unemployment problem amongst the youth whether educated or uneducated as all are facing neglect at every level.
“It is known to one and all that the J&K Subordinate Selection Board including the Departmental Selection Committees of the State Government are earning crores of rupees against the sale of forms which is quite inhumane in view of the fact that against 10000 forms the selection for appointment goes to a few lucky persons and others continue to fill forms until they get over-aged”, he added.
He appealed to the Chief Minister to stop the practice of earning revenue from poor unemployed youth and their parents and devise ways and means to provide them financial assistance for their survival.
Bhardwaj also appealed to the Chief Minister to give a sincere thinking to the problem being faced by unemployed youth and sale the form on minimum charge of Rs 10 to get the amount back, which Government spent on stationery/printing.
The meeting was also attended by Working President MS Katoch, Inderjeet Khajuria, Narayan Singh, Gajan Singh Khajuria, ML Sharma, Avinash Bhatia, Prof BL Bhardwaj, RL Tandon, etc.
